VS:PushAttrs

Description
Stores current attribute, tool, text, and constraint settings for later retrieval as the document default settings. Document settings can be modified as needed after using this call, and the stored settings can be restored with a call to PopAttrs. Calling this function more than once (nested) is allowed. The settings will be placed on a stack, and will be retrieved by calls to PopAttrs in the correct sequence.
PROCEDURE PushAttrs;
def vs.PushAttrs(): return None
Remarks
Boolean textV; // true if picked up from textNode Boolean markV; // true if picked up from markered object ObjectColorType cType; // color record short ppat; // pen pattern short fPat; // fill pattern ByClassFlagsType isByClass; // whether graphic attributes are 'by class'; LineType lType; // line width-dash TDashPat lDashPat; // dash pattern definition SegStyleType sType; // marker size and placement short tFont; // font number short tSize; // font size in pagespace Style tStyle; // text style Byte tSpace; // text spacing Byte tJust; // text justification Str255 cName; // class name long wBits; // bitfield of which attrs to paste ObjRecHandle dataList; short toolID; // active tool
The fields 'wBits' and 'dataList' do not appear to be used.
Example
VectorScript
PROCEDURE Example; BEGIN PushAttrs; PenFore(215); PenBack(5); PenPat(25); PenSize(42); PenPat(25); SetConstrain('q'); CallTool(-201); PopAttrs; END; RUN(Example);
